AMD 2× M88-LXT

The AMD 2× M88-LXT is a dual-GPU graphics card released in 2008, based on the TeraScale architecture with two R680 chips.

The AMD 2× M88-LXT is a dual-GPU graphics card released on September 1, 2008. It uses two R680 chips built on a 55 nm process, featuring a total of 640 shading units. The card operates at a base clock of 660 MHz and is equipped with 1 GB of GDDR3 memory on a 512-bit bus, providing a memory bandwidth of 108.8 GB/s. It supports DirectX 10.1 and OpenGL 2.0 (3.3). The card has a board power (TDP) of 110 W and connects via PCIe ×16 2.0. It includes UVD and PowerPlay 7.0 technologies.
